This 2022 Porsche 911 Targa 4S is currently available for sale with only 6,000 km on the clock at a price of 8.99 billion VND.

A recently listed 2022 Porsche 911 Targa 4S has caught the attention of many due to its unexpectedly low mileage of 6,000 km and a selling price of 8.99 billion VND.

This particular car comes with a range of additional options, adding up to a total estimated value of over 2 billion VND. These options include a brown leather interior with Crayon stitching, sport exhaust system, self-adjusting Matrix LED headlights, and 20/21 inch Turbo Design wheels, among others.

When originally purchased, the Porsche 911 Targa 4S had a base price of 9.85 billion VND from the manufacturer. With the added options, the total estimated cost exceeded 12 billion VND (including all on-road costs). This means that the Porsche 911 Targa 4S has depreciated by over 3 billion VND in value.

The Targa version is a well-known variant in the Porsche 911 series. It features a convertible design with a distinctive glass dome at the rear, providing a unique aesthetic whether the top is up or down. The Porsche 911 Targa 4S showcased in this article comes in a special color called “graphite blue metallic,” with an additional cost of 80 million VND.

Similar to other Porsche 911 models, the Targa 4S is equipped with Matrix LED headlights, an optional feature that costs over 188 million VND. The car also showcases 19-inch front and 20-inch rear multi-spoke wheels with a dark tint, priced at over 230 million VND. Additionally, a manual or automatic rear wing can be raised at high speeds to enhance downforce.

Inside the cabin, the Porsche 911 Targa 4S is fitted with optional sports seats, valued at up to 222 million VND. The interior features a dominant brown color scheme with Crayon stitching, costing approximately 351 million VND. The car also offers other optional features such as the Bose 12-speaker surround sound system (92 million VND), yellow seat belts (28 million VND), yellow steering wheel clock (22 million VND), and yellow center Sport Chrono clock (22 million VND), among others.

The Porsche 911 Targa 4S comes standard with a large 10.9-inch infotainment screen positioned in the center, featuring a split instrument cluster with an analog speedometer and four digital gauges. The car is equipped with real-time navigation, Wi-Fi connectivity, and offers wireless connectivity with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to.

Powering the 992 generation Porsche 911 Targa 4S is a 3.0-liter 6-cylinder engine, delivering a maximum power output of 443 horsepower and a peak torque of 528 Nm. This engine is paired with an 8-speed dual-clutch transmission and rear-wheel drive.
